...A strong thunderstorm will impact portions of southwestern Burke
County through MIDNIGHT EDT...

At 1111 PM EDT, Doppler radar was tracking a strong thunderstorm near
Louisville, moving southeast at 20 mph.

HAZARD...Wind gusts up to 45 mph and half inch hail.

SOURCE...Radar indicated.

IMPACT...Gusty winds could knock down tree limbs and blow around
         unsecured objects. Minor damage to outdoor objects is
         possible.

Locations impacted include...
Midville, Vidette, Di-
Lane Wildlife Management Area, Magruder, and Rosier.

PRECAUTIONARY/PREPAREDNESS ACTIONS...

If outdoors, consider seeking shelter inside a building.

Torrential rainfall is also occurring with this storm and may lead to
localized flooding. Do not drive your vehicle through flooded
roadways.
